GPU加速深度学习算法实战指南 在高性能计算(HPC)领域,GPU加速深度学习算法一直是一个备受关注的话题。随着深度学习在各个领域的广泛应用,对于如何利用GPU来加快深度学习算法的训练和推理过程变得越来越重要。 首先,GPU(Graphics Processing Unit)是一种专门用于图形处理的处理器,但是由于其强大的并行计算能力,近年来被广泛应用于深度学习领域。相比于传统的CPU(Central Processing Unit),GPU能够同时处理大量的数据和计算任务,从而大大加快了深度学习算法的训练和推理速度。 在深度学习算法中,大量的矩阵运算和张量计算是不可避免的。而GPU正是在这方面表现出色,其并行计算能力能够高效地处理这些计算任务,从而大大缩短了深度学习算法的执行时间。 除了加速深度学习算法的训练和推理过程,GPU还能够为深度学习算法提供更大的模型容量和更高的精度。通过GPU并行计算的优势,可以更快地训练出更复杂的深度学习模型,从而在各种领域取得更好的性能表现。 然而,要充分发挥GPU加速深度学习算法的优势,并不是一件容易的事情。首先,需要对深度学习算法和GPU硬件架构有深入的了解,才能够设计高效的算法和并行计算方案。 其次,还需要针对具体的深度学习任务和数据特点进行优化,包括模型设计、数据预处理、并行计算和内存管理等方面的优化。只有在这些方面都做到了充分的优化,才能够充分发挥GPU加速深度学习算法的性能优势。 在实际的深度学习应用中,GPU加速深度学习算法已经取得了许多成功的案例。从图像识别、语音识别到自然语言处理,GPU加速深度学习算法在各种领域都展现了出色的性能,为人工智能技术的发展做出了重要贡献。 总之,GPU加速深度学习算法实战指南是一本极具实用价值的书籍,它将帮助读者深入了解GPU加速深度学习算法的原理和实践,从而更好地应用GPU技术来加速自己的深度学习项目。希望本文所介绍的内容能够帮助读者更好地理解和应用GPU加速深度学习算法,为HPC领域的发展贡献一份力量。 |
说点什么...